Strong words from John Pilger - https://twitter.com/johnpilger/status/1252107214396854272

“When Jeremy Hunt was UK Health Secretary the stockpile of PPE was cut by 40 per cent. In 2016, he oversaw Exercise Cygnus that predicted the NHS he was starving to death could not cope with a pandemic. He ignored it. Prosecute Hunt for criminal negligence.”

^ link to article:-

Exercise Cygnus uncovered: the pandemic warnings buried by the government - at The Telegraph

Until 2012, Remploy also made specialist PPE & Uniforms for the NHS and other emergency services:-

Remploy staff protest against factory closures - from 2012, at The Guardian.
